TroubleShoot HTML5 y WebRTC Streaming en VideoWhisper

Identifique y solucione los problemas que pueden ocurrir después de que la solución VideoWhisper se haya configurado correctamente, probado y en ejecución.
Si no lo tiene instalado, sin embargo, obtener un plan para una solución llave en mano, en ejemplo para HTML5 Videochat .

Los problemas de transmisión pueden tener varias causas: configuración de configuración, conexión a Internet del usuario al servidor de streaming, condiciones de red e idoneidad del protocolo de streaming, tipo de navegador y versión.

Here’s algunos posibles problemas y pasos para identificar su causa y posibles correcciones.

Pixelación de vídeo, baja calidad

-Compruebe la resolución de streaming seleccionada & velocidad de bits y también mediciones reales de velocidad de bits de streaming (disponible en Aplicación HTML5 Videochat).
Intente ajustar la velocidad de bits de streaming y compruebe si la velocidad de bits real se logra en función de la nueva configuración.
-WebRTC también adapta la calidad dependiendo de la conexión disponible y las condiciones de red para UDP. Also try RTMP TCP broadcasting with OBS / GoCoder u otros codificadores, como se menciona a continuación.
-Si se producen problemas tanto para WebRTC como para RTMP streaming, medir su conexión a Internet (ver instrucciones a continuación).

Interrupciones de transmisión por streaming de emisoras, errores frecuentes, sitio web lento durante la transmisión

Algunos organismos de radiodifusión pueden experimentar problemas debido a su velocidad de conexión a Internet, ubicación (muy lejos del servidor de streaming). Tener una conexión más baja requiere ajustar la velocidad de bits máxima de streaming, por lo que no consume todo el ancho de banda disponible.

1) Hacer una prueba de velocidad de localización de difusión a una ubicación de servidor de streaming.
1. Vete a https://www.speedtest.net .
2. Cambiar servidor y buscar un servidor en Beauharnois (América del norte).
3. Pulse GO para iniciar la medición.
3. Obtenga el enlace de medición desde el icono superior izquierdo y compártalo con nuestro personal.
La conexión de carga de los organismos de radiodifusión debe manejar el vídeo + audio y también otras interacciones y solicitudes web.

2) En algunas condiciones de red, la transmisión por secuencias UDP puede no funcionar en absoluto o proporcionar baja velocidad de bits y fiabilidad (mostrando como pixelación, interrupciones).

Broadcaster puede descargar OBS para PC / GoCoder para móviles por instrucciones en la pestaña Difusión para transmitir con RTMP TCP en lugar de WebRTC UDP.

Connection to sever is high and streaming quality is low/DISRUPTED, aunque configurado alta tasa de bits en la configuración

– Compruebe las estadísticas de velocidad de bits en vivo en la aplicación HTML5 Videochat.
Try OBS / GoCoder RTMP streaming.
Si la velocidad de bits de conexión es alta y la velocidad de bits de transmisión en vivo es inferior a la configurada, issue could be related to network conditions and WebRTC protocol streaming over UDP. For higher quality and reliability, radiodifusión es posible utilizando una aplicación RTMP TCP como OBS para escritorio o GoCoder móvil, directamente al servidor de streaming sin depender del navegador web. La secuencia RTMP se entrega a los usuarios del sitio como HTML5 HLS.

Error de transmisión del navegador de la emisora, Mensaje de reintento, errores de permiso, cámara no disponible en la lista

– Asegúrese de que está cargando el sitio a través de HTTPS (requerido para publicar la cámara).
– Reiniciar el navegador.
– Prueba con un navegador diferente: Cromo, Firefox, Valiente, Safari.
Pruebe el Navegador valiente (Horquilla centrada en la privacidad de Chrome).

Problemas de conexión intermitente asociados con sitio lento o intermitente 503 errores web

Los recursos de alojamiento web pueden estar insuficientes para la complejidad y la carga del sitio.
-Try reducing site complexity (eliminando plugins) y la carga de recursos por solicitud.
-Actualice a un plan superior desde HTML5 WebRTC Relay Hosting .

Transmisión de transmisión que no se conecta ni se desconecta

Compruebe si la tasa de bits (vídeo + audio) está dentro de los límites de alojamiento del plan. Intentar emitir una velocidad de bits más alta resultará en un rechazo automatizado de la secuencia y un tiempo de reutilización corto, mientras que todos los intentos de conexión son rechazados.
Consulte Carga de clientes (Kbps) para su plan en HTML5 WebRTC Relay Hosting y configurar más bajo.

Ciertos usuarios solo pueden transmitir

– Problema del navegador: Actualice el navegador a la última versión o pruebe un navegador HTML5 diferente como Navegador valiente . El navegador debe admitir las últimas características y códecs de WebRTC. Los navegadores y versiones más antiguos no funcionarán (en Windows use Edge no Internet Explorer).
– Problema de red: Pruebe con otro protocolo de red: Broadcaster puede descargar OBS para PC / GoCoder para móviles por instrucciones en la pestaña Difusión para transmitir con RTMP TCP en lugar de WebRTC UDP.
– Problema del cortafuegos: Si el usuario tiene un firewall puede deshabilitarlo temporalmente para identificar si esa es la causa. Los puertos y protocolos necesarios dependen del método de transmisión, configuración del servidor y del sitio.

Los visitantes no pueden conectarse ni transmitir (sin inicio de sesión)

Los problemas de solo visitantes son más probables relacionados con la caché y el sitio que sirve contenido estático a sus solicitudes.
En WP Super Cache puede desactivar la caché para los visitantes del sitio que tienen cookies.

Sin sonido

– Broadcaster necesita seleccionar el dispositivo de entrada correcto (Micrófono). al transmitir. Abra la pestaña de difusión para realizar cambios en los dispositivos/ajustes de entrada.
– Los espectadores necesitan usar “Toque para sonido” botón para activar el audio.
Los navegadores requieren la interacción del usuario para permitir la reproducción automatizada de vídeo con sonido. A veces la reproducción no está permitida en absoluto y la aplicación mostrará una “Toque para reproducir” Botón.
Esta es una función del navegador / Restricción.
– Intente volver a cargar la secuencia o la página. Dependiendo de las condiciones de la red y del navegador, flujo de audio a veces puede faltar de la difusión UDP de WebRTC. Pruebe la transmisión de OBS/GoCoder a través de RTMP TCP para aumentar la confiabilidad.

Webcam or Microphone Not Accessible

The web based applications use devices provided by system / browser to WebRTC . Pruebe el WebRTC samples to check available devices. If system / browser does not make it accessible for WebRTC usage, the WebRTC based application can’t access it.
-Try a different navegador.
-Try broadcasting with OBS with settings from Broadcast tab.
-If available, try the legacy Flash based applications.
-For more details about browser WebRTC support, check with hardware provider support.

Aplicación de HTML5 – Actualizado

Aplicación de Videochat de HTML5 funciona en la mayoría de los navegadores, incluyendo móviles iOS/Android y aplicaciones a través de la tecnología WebRTC una retransmisión streaming server para fiabilidad y escalamiento.

Ha incluido como interfaz con PaidVideoChat.com solución que ofrece 2 capacidades de videochat de manera (como se muestra en privado a petición). Ahora pueden seleccionar artistas para empezar a utilizar la sala Interfaz de la aplicación HTML5 y está disponible para todos los usuarios.

HTML5: Vista de cliente en 2 Videochat de manera, Consejos

Vista de cliente: Aplicación de videochat de HTML5 compatible con funciones como cartera con saldo vivo, Consejos, privado 2 videochat de forma muestra con contador.

Emergente de diálogo de solicitud de Show privado.

Vista de la emisora

La aplicación de HTML5 VideoWhisper está construida en reaccionar y puede ser adaptada para ediciones reaccionar nativa para iOS / Android.